Power BI Visualizations are interactive graphical representations created within Microsoft Power BI, a business analytics platform. These visualizations enable users to translate complex data sets into easily interpretable charts, dashboards, and reports, facilitating data-driven decision-making across organizations.
Key Features
- Wide variety of visualization types including bar charts, pie charts, maps, gauges, and custom visuals
- Interactive features such as filtering, drill-downs, and hover effects
- Support for custom visual development via the Power BI Visuals SDK
- Real-time data updates and connectivity with diverse data sources
- Integration with other Microsoft tools and cloud services
- Export options for sharing reports externally or embedding in websites
Pros
- User-friendly interface with drag-and-drop functionality
- Highly customizable visual options to fit specific analytical needs
- Extensive community support and a rich marketplace for custom visuals
- Facilitates clear and compelling data storytelling
- Seamless integration with Microsoft ecosystems like Azure and Excel
Cons
- Learning curve for advanced features and custom visual development
- Performance issues may arise with very large datasets or complex visuals
- Limited offline capabilities; primarily cloud-based solution
- Some visual customization options require knowledge of DAX or R/Python scripting
